A is defined as an event that results in an individual coming to rest inadvertently on the ground or flooring or various other reduced degree (WHO, 2021).
According to the Centers for Condition Control and Prevention (CDC),, causing over 34,000 deaths for that age. Falling is the second leading reason of fatality from unintentional injuries globally. Death from falls is a severe and endemic issue among older individuals. It is estimated that fall death prices in the U.S

Each year, over 800,000 clients are hospitalized because of falls. Nurses play a major role in protecting against falls for their individuals through education and learning, assessing fall risk, creating more secure atmospheres, and giving interventions in protecting against injuries from falls.

Individuals are more most likely to drop once more if they have actually sustained one or more falls in the previous 6 linked here months. The older population is at raised danger of fall-related readmissions based on a study recognizing the aspects anticipating of repeat falls connected results (Prabhakaran et al., 2020).
Furthermore, confusion and damaged judgment enhance the person's visit this page chance of falling. The capacity of individuals to safeguard themselves from falls is affected by such aspects as age and advancement. Older people with weak muscles are more probable to drop than those that maintain muscular tissue toughness, flexibility, and endurance. These changes include reduced visual function, impaired color assumption, modification in center of mass, unstable stride, lowered muscle stamina, lowered endurance, modified depth assumption, and postponed reaction and response times.

Much less comparison sensitivity was fairly related to both boosted rates of drops and other injuries, while decreased visual acuity was just connected with boosted fall rate (Wood et al., 2011). Sensory perception of environmental stimulations is extremely important to safety and security. Vision and hearing disability restriction the client's capability to view dangers in the environments.
Older adults that have bad balance or problem strolling are more probable to drop. These problems may be related to absence of exercise or a neurological reason, arthritis, or other clinical problems and therapies. An important threat element highlighted in a research study is that adults with rheumatoid arthritis are at high threat of falls, including swollen and tender lower extremity joints, tiredness, and use psychotropic drugs (Stanmore et al., 2013).
